ICE*_*ICE 30 gnome nvidia xorg drivers 18.04
在我安装了带有 GNOME 桌面的全新 Ubuntu 18.04 并且它有开源驱动程序后,我遇到了非常严重的延迟。
我安装了 Nvidia 390 驱动程序,延迟非常严重。将驱动程序更改为 Nvidia 340.106 没有帮助。
我认为这是关于 Ubuntu 18.04,所以我安装了 Fedora 28。在 Wayland 上,开源驱动程序一切都很顺利,但是在安装 390 驱动程序并切换到 X11 之后,延迟开始(但没有 Ubuntu 那么糟糕)。
我安装了 GNOME Impatience 扩展来减少延迟,但它并没有多大帮助。
我还尝试了 Ubuntu Mate 18.04 和 COMPIZ。在 Mate 上,我有更重的效果,但这些效果非常流畅。
我尝试过的另一个 Ubuntu 18.04 是基于相同 GNOME 的 Budige。它根本没有任何滞后。
还从“ppa:graphics-drivers/ppa”存储库安装了 Nvidia 396(开源)。它只是滞后更多。
编辑:
安装sudo ubuntu-drivers autoinstall并没有解决问题。它只是安装了我之前尝试过的 Nvidia 390 驱动程序。
我没有任何高 CPU 使用率问题:
nvidia-smi 结果:
+------------------------------------------------------+
| NVIDIA-SMI 340.106 Driver Version: 340.106 |
|-------------------------------+----------------------+----------------------+
| GPU Name Persistence-M| Bus-Id Disp.A | Volatile Uncorr. ECC |
| Fan Temp Perf Pwr:Usage/Cap| Memory-Usage | GPU-Util Compute M. |
|===============================+======================+======================|
| 0 GeForce GTX 660 Ti Off | 0000:03:00.0 N/A | N/A |
| 10% 32C P8 N/A / N/A | 273MiB / 2047MiB | N/A Default |
+-------------------------------+----------------------+----------------------+
+-----------------------------------------------------------------------------+
| Compute processes: GPU Memory |
| GPU PID Process name Usage |
|=============================================================================|
| 0 Not Supported |
+-----------------------------------------------------------------------------+
Run Code Online (Sandbox Code Playgroud)
无论如何,我可以解决这个滞后问题吗?
我也遇到了同样的情况。确保:
我在 Ubuntu 18.04 上停止使用 Gnome 3,并使用 lightdm 显示管理器将其替换为 Mate 桌面。
复制:
sudo apt install tasksel
sudo apt update
sudo tasksel install ubuntu-mate-desktop
sudo dpkg-reconfigure lightdm
sudo shutdown -r now
Run Code Online (Sandbox Code Playgroud)
AFAIK Gnome 不适用于 18.04 nVidia。
我能够在 18.04 + GSYNC 上的 Compiz 上获得 144 FPS。(我在 Gnome 上只得到了 40-60 fps,没有 GSYNC)我第一次尝试 Compiz 时,它不起作用(我在 nVidia 396 上),我做到了sudo ubuntu-drivers autoinstall(这让我在 390 上),然后我重新启动,然后使用登录时使用小选择器图标来选择 Compiz,效果非常好。所以我认为396还不能与 compiz 一起使用,但390可以。奇怪的是,390在 Gnome 上让我对显示器感到恶心,但在 compiz 上却没问题,所以我认为390在 Gnome 上有很多奇怪的刷新率/重画问题。
(这可能是 GSYNC 的问题,但我确实在右上角看到了一个像素化的单词“NORMAL”,我通过在 中关闭 OpengGL 来摆脱它nvidia-settings)